Downspout diverter services involve installing specialized devices that redirect water from your home's downspouts away from the foundation or areas where water buildup can cause problems. These systems are designed to control the flow of rainwater, ensuring that excess water is diverted safely away from the house. Proper installation can help prevent water from pooling near the foundation, which can lead to structural damage or basement flooding over time. Local contractors who specialize in downspout diverters can assess a property's specific drainage needs and recommend the best solutions to keep water moving effectively.
Many property owners turn to downspout diverter services when facing issues related to improper water drainage. Common problems include water pooling around the foundation, basement leaks, or erosion along the property's perimeter. These issues are often worsened during heavy rains or snowmelt, making effective water management essential. Installing a diverter can help mitigate these concerns by controlling where and how rainwater is directed, reducing the risk of damage and costly repairs. Homeowners with older homes or properties situated on slopes frequently find this service particularly beneficial.

What is a downspout diverter? A downspout diverter is a device that redirects rainwater from a home's downspout to a designated area, helping prevent water from pooling near the foundation.
How can a downspout diverter benefit my property? Installing a diverter can reduce basement flooding, prevent soil erosion, and help manage rainwater runoff more effectively around a property.
Are downspout diverter services suitable for all types of homes? Yes, local contractors can assess different home styles and install diverters that work with various gutter systems and property layouts.
What types of downspout diverters are available? There are several options, including inline diverters, pop-up diverters, and splash blocks, which local service providers can recommend based on specific needs.
